This Is War: New York Housing Advocates, Hotels and Airbnb Fight to Define Narrative

Battleground

Friday morning in New York City, affordable housing advocates rallied in front of city hall to combat "illegal hotels," which they say take away stock from the housing supply. The group, which is calling itself the #ShareBetter Coalition and includes dozens of local politicians, identifies short-term rental site Airbnb as a primary opponent.


Airbnb, however, says the campaign is the work of the hotel industry.



"Some in the hotel industry are launching a campaign to try and stop home sharing in New York," Airbnb's Marc Pomeranc wrote in a blog post Friday. "Media reports indicate that some misinformed hotels are willing to spend millions of dollars because they don’t think regular New Yorkers should be able to share the home in which they live."
